Output 8281ede078f256eb80479a193cde90d3e0c14c24e8efdf60731c83e0243b0d7e:0

value
1048446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a9a8bd8c22e5375ad70b169569fe17951bdb0ae OP_EQUAL
address
3FnV89c2p3ibkWSTvRXmPwVvvh9EFV6jBi
transaction
8281ede078f256eb80479a193cde90d3e0c14c24e8efdf60731c83e0243b0d7e
confirmations
340932
spent
true